The Emotional Spectrum in Gaming: Beyond Rational Choices
Players experience a vast range of emotions during gameplay, from excitement and joy to frustration and fear. Unlike purely rational decision models, emotional states deeply influence how players perceive risks and rewards. For instance, a surge of adrenaline during a tense moment may prompt a player to take a daring risk they would typically avoid. Research indicates that heightened emotional intensity can significantly increase risk-taking behaviors, as players seek thrill or validation, often overriding logical considerations.
A compelling example is horror games, where fear amplifies engagement and can lead players to make split-second decisions driven more by emotional survival instincts than strategic planning. Similarly, moments of joy or achievement can reinforce positive behaviors, shaping future decision patterns within the game environment.
Emotional Triggers and Their Role in Shaping Player Preferences
Game design elements—such as music, visual effects, narrative twists, and character interactions—serve as emotional triggers that influence player preferences and choices. For example, a hero’s sacrifice scene might evoke empathy, prompting players to support altruistic decisions in subsequent gameplay. Personal emotional associations also play a role; players who associate certain game themes with nostalgic memories may be more inclined to favor specific options that resonate with those feelings.
Furthermore, the interplay between emotional states and narrative engagement creates a feedback loop, where emotional investment deepens, reinforcing preferences and guiding decision-making along personalized paths. This personalization enhances immersion and emotional satisfaction, critical factors in retaining player engagement.
The Influence of Emotions on In-Game Moral and Ethical Decisions
Emotional arousal is a key driver in moral dilemmas faced during gameplay. For instance, feelings of guilt or anger can sway players toward certain choices, such as punishing an antagonist or forgiving a rival. Empathy, in particular, acts as a powerful decision modifier; players who emotionally connect with characters are more likely to act compassionately, even when the game presents conflicting incentives.
However, emotional fatigue from prolonged exposure to complex scenarios can lead to decision avoidance—a phenomenon supported by psychological studies indicating that intense emotional burden may cause players to disengage or opt for simpler, less emotionally taxing options. This dynamic underscores the importance of emotional pacing within game narratives to maintain ethical engagement without overwhelming players.
Adaptive Game Mechanics: Leveraging Emotions to Guide Player Behavior
Modern games increasingly incorporate adaptive mechanics designed to evoke specific emotional responses. For example, reward systems that celebrate daring choices with visual and auditory cues can amplify feelings of achievement, motivating continued risk-taking. Conversely, punishments delivered through somber sound design and visual cues can induce frustration or caution.
Dynamic difficulty adjustments (DDA) also respond to inferred emotional states—if a player exhibits signs of frustration or boredom, the game may subtly lower difficulty or alter scenarios to re-engage their emotional investment. Emotional feedback systems—such as real-time biometric sensors—can provide developers with data to tailor experiences, fostering a balanced emotional landscape that guides players toward desired behaviors.
Player Emotions as Data: Implications for Game Design and Personalization
By utilizing biometric data—such as heart rate, galvanic skin response, or facial expression analysis—developers can infer players’ emotional states with increasing accuracy. This data enables real-time personalization, where game environments adapt dynamically to optimize emotional engagement and decision-making processes.
For example, if a player’s biometric indicators suggest rising anxiety during a stealth sequence, the game might adjust light levels or provide subtle hints to reduce stress without diminishing challenge. Such tailored experiences can deepen immersion and promote healthier emotional regulation within gameplay.
However, these advancements raise ethical considerations regarding data privacy and consent, emphasizing the need for transparent and responsible use of emotional data in game design.
Emotional Resilience and Decision-Making: Preparing Players for Challenging Choices
Emotional resilience—the ability to manage and recover from emotional distress—is crucial in navigating complex or morally ambiguous scenarios. Games that incorporate resilience-building mechanics, such as reflective pauses or calming environments, help players develop emotional regulation skills that transfer beyond gaming.
Strategies like guided breathing exercises, positive reinforcement, and narrative cues can foster emotional regulation, enabling players to approach difficult decisions with clarity rather than impulsivity. Balancing emotional engagement with cognitive clarity ensures that players remain motivated and psychologically healthy, even during intense gameplay moments.
